How do we know that true believers will not be forsaken?

Psalm 37:25 affirms that true believers are never forsaken, as God faithfully provides for them.

In Psalm 37:25, David confidently declares, 'I have been young, and now am old; yet have I not seen the righteous forsaken, nor his seed begging bread.' This statement underlines the unwavering faithfulness of God towards His people throughout generations. Despite the hardships that believers may experience, the assurance is clear: God does not abandon His righteous ones. The evidence of God’s provision and care for His people strengthens our trust because it is grounded in God's immutable nature and promises, reinforcing the belief that He will always uphold the righteous.
